Royal Caribbean

Royal Caribbean has the second most cruise ships (24) in their fleet and will welcome another six ships over the next seven years.

  • Spectrum of the Seas (2019) 168,666 GT, 4,200 passengers
  • Odyssey of the Seas (2020) 168,666 GT, 4,200 passengers
  • 5th Oasis Class Ship (2021) 230,000 GT, 6,780 passengers
  • 1st Icon Class Ship (2022)  200,000 GT, 5,000 passengers
  • 6th Oasis Class Ship (2023) 230,000 GT, 6,780 passengers
  • 2nd Icon Class Ship (2024)  200,000 GT, 5,000 passengers
